举例说明一下try/except/finally的用法。 若不使用try/except/finally 输出: 使用try/except/finally: 第一: try不仅捕获异常,而且会恢复执行 输出: 第二 ...
try except与try finally不同之处 try 尝试执行 SomeCode except 出错的时候执行, Except有特定的错误类型 SomeCode end try 尝试执行 SomeCode finally 无论如何都强制执行 SomeCode end 例:tryAge: StrToInt Edit .Text ShowMessage Format 生于 d年 , YearO ...
2018-09-04 12:09 0 942 推荐指数:
举例说明一下try/except/finally的用法。 若不使用try/except/finally 输出: 使用try/except/finally: 第一: try不仅捕获异常,而且会恢复执行 输出: 第二 ...
try,except,finally try...except形式:指定一个或多个异常处理器(异常子句).。 当在try子句中没有异常发生时,,异常处理器将不被执行. 当在try子句中有异常发生时,首先会执行except搜索异常处理器,它会按顺序搜索直到第一个匹配的处理器找到为止 ...
异常处理:try-except语句 1) 此处:as reason为可选参数,reason是一个变量。 2) 使用try—except语句时,检测范围内出现错误,不会有红色的报错提示,而是执行“异常出现后的处理代码”。 3) 一个try可以和多个 ...
异常Error 我们在写代码的时候,经常会遇见程序抛出Error无法执行的情况 一般情况下,在Python无法正常处理程序时就会发生一个异常。异常是Python对象,表示一个错误。当Python脚本发生异常时我们需要捕获处理它,否则程序会终止执行。 try...except ...
def test1(): try: print('to do stuff') raise Exception('hehe') print('to return in try') return 'try' except Exception ...
1.python中try/except/else/finally正常的语句是这样的: try: normal excute block except A: Except A handle except B: Except B handle ...
格式: 完整的格式顺序是:try —> except X —> except —> else—> finally 如果 else 和 finally 都存在的话,else 必须在 finally 之前,finally 必须在整个程序的最后。 else 的存在 ...
写代码的时候发现了好玩的事情,常常作为终止的 return 语句并不总是能够立刻跳出函数 这段代码得到的运行结果是 对于另外一段代码 函数的返回值仍然是 5,并没有改为 10 而当 try 或 except 和 finally 中同时出现 return 的时候,返回值 ...